What is the 86 Calling Code?

The 86 calling code is the internationally recognized dialing code assigned to China by the International Telecommunication Union (ITU). It facilitates calls to and from China, connecting people globally with individuals, businesses, and institutions within the country. This three-digit code is an integral part of the global numbering system designed to streamline international communication.

When dialing a number in China from another country, the 86 calling code must precede the local number. For instance, to reach a number in Beijing, which has the area code 10, you would dial +86 10 followed by the local number. This systematic approach ensures that your call is accurately routed through the international telecommunication network.

How the 86 Calling Code Works

The 86 calling code operates in tandem with other components of the telephone number, including:

  • Country Code: The +86 prefix directs the call specifically to China.
  • Area Code: Each region or city in China has its unique area code, such as 10 for Beijing or 21 for Shanghai.
  • Local Number: The final segment of the number is the subscriber's local number, which varies in length depending on the region.

This structured format ensures that calls are directed accurately to their intended destination within China, irrespective of the caller's location.

How to Use the 86 Calling Code

Utilizing the 86 calling code is straightforward, provided you pay attention to detail to ensure your call is properly connected. Follow these steps to dial a number in China:

  1. Dial the international access code for your country (e.g., 00 for many countries or +).
  2. Input the 86 calling code.
  3. Add the area code corresponding to the specific city or region in China.
  4. Finally, dial the local number.

For example, to reach a number in Shanghai, which has the area code 21, you would dial +86 21 followed by the local number.

Can the 86 Calling Code Be Used to Call Hong Kong or Macau?

No, Hong Kong and Macau have their own distinct international dialing codes. Hong Kong utilizes the +852 code, while Macau employs +853. These regions are treated as separate entities for telecommunications purposes.

Verify the Time Difference

China operates on China Standard Time (CST), which is 8 h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time (UTC+8). Account for this difference when scheduling calls to avoid inconvenient timing.
